Church/Chapel: Boldron Mission Church
Country Name: England
Location: North Yorkshire, Yorkshire and the Humber
Directions to Site: Located near Bowes, about 25 km from Richmond
Font Location in Church: Inside the church
Century and Period: 10th - 11th century, Pre-Conquest
The notes on the history of Boldron in Tomorrows History site [www.tomorrows-history.com] read: "The Church [i.e., the Mission Church bbuilt in 1888] has what is thought to ba a Saxon font, perhaps from the church at Startforth, as are the present pews." [NB: unable to confirm this information]. [cf. Index entry for Startforth for a 15th-century font in that church]
